I noticed you mentioning datasource as one of the properties not visible within
VFP. This may be because the version you have is expecting to be bound to a VB data control? Perhaps another version of the spread control can connect to an alternate data source such as an OLEDB or ADO recordset provider, and might be visible in VFP?
What version of the ActiveX do you have?
There are sometimes different controls within the same release that use different data sources.

If you wish to populate the grid, can you do it manually with AddRow/AddItem or the equivalent?
I've forgotten the syntax for this control, but it may not have any add methods at all and you may just have to set rows and columns properties and fill them in like an array.
